Casuarina Beach Club in Phuket sits right on the shoreline at the Dusit Thani Laguna Phuket resort, and it also welcomes non‑hotel guests via a separate entrance. After a recent renovation, the venue feels fresh and well kept, and dining by the water turns a meal into a calm, unhurried ritual set to the sound of the waves.
Its biggest draw is the prime beachfront location: a quiet bay, soft sunset light, and tables overlooking the coast. Live music is sometimes played in the evenings, yet the overall mood stays relaxed and intimate — an easy choice for a romantic dinner or a long, leisurely lunch.
The menu leans toward European tastes; there are no Thai dishes. You’ll find salads, sandwiches and burgers, sushi, and a strong seafood and fish selection — octopus with vegetables, fish cakes, grilled sea bass, mussels, ceviche, and tartares (including tuna). Plates are neatly presented with a restaurant-style touch, and the wine list is a solid one.
Desserts are a reason to stop by on their own: the crème brûlée and lemon tart stand out for their well-balanced flavors. Prices are above average, especially at dinner, and the restaurant can get busy at peak times, so booking ahead is recommended. On rare occasions service can feel uneven, and the kitchen and bar aren’t always flawless in the small details; still, the staff is generally attentive and friendly. The restaurant also closes fairly early, which is worth keeping in mind when planning your evening.
